1883 Wood Engraving Portrait Aqsaqal Aksakal Elders Caucasus Judge XEGA3 XAF4 Produced by Milton Sperling andThis is an original 1883 black and white in text wood engraving of Aqsaqals (Aksakals) who are the male elders of the village. Their name means "white beard" and these men acted as advisors of judges and had a role in politics and the justice system in villages through out Central Asia and Caucasus.
